'Fable 2' given Xbox 360 release date
Published Friday, Aug 8 2008, 15:47 BST | By Alex Fletcher

The Lionhead-developed RPG will be released in Europe on October 24.
Fable 2 is an adventure game that allows gamers to raise families, build relationships or start conflicts with people. It is based around practical and moral dilemmas.
According to Eurogamer, the sequel will have a simplified control system and drop-in/drop-out co-operative play on Xbox Live.
A Limited Collector's Edition version of the game has also been confirmed. The bonus DVD will feature behind-the-scenes video, a collectible Hobbe figure, five Fate cards, a 48-hour XBL Gold trial and bonus in-game content.
